IHRC Corporation is an intergovernmental and transnational entity that serves as the central governing body within the global IHRC Alliance. As a neutral, independent organization, it is steadfastly dedicated to preserving peace, defending human rights, and ensuring international stability through multilateral diplomacy and humanitarian engagement.
At the heart of its mission stands the IHRC Peacemaker Force a specialized diplomatic and mediatory unit designed to prevent conflict, de-escalate tensions, and facilitate dialogue in the world's most volatile regions. Through this innovative approach, IHRC Corporation offers a unique and proactive model for sustainable conflict resolution and global cooperation.
The IHRC Alliance works tirelessly to protect vulnerable populations, support communities affected by crises, and deliver targeted humanitarian aid, while actively promoting peace-building initiatives and inclusive development. Rooted in international law and guided by universal values, IHRC remains an unwavering symbol of neutrality, trust, and global partnership in an increasingly divided world.

INTERNATIONAL LOCAL PARTNERSHIP (ILOPA)

As part of the "IHRC International Local Partnership" program, was signed a Memorandum of Understanding with the local authorities of territories and cities in Europe, Africa and Asia. This program is to create a platform for local authorities from around the world to improve the quality and effectiveness of their service to their local communities thanks to ongoing, close and direct cooperation.
